I'd stop short of calling the Europa league pointless but it is an unnecessary distraction based on the number of games required to be played to progress. It's exactly this type of competition (champions league included) which fuels the big squad culture giving rise to unsustainable spending. It's progressively driving a bigger wedge between the big money teams and those who aren't so prosperous. By the time UEFA, FIFA and teh premier league decide that it's time for change it'll be too late. |

Incidentally while listening to the often excellent Football Weekly I found out that AFC Wimbledon, the club set up by fans after their old club, Wimbledon, were moved to Milton Keynes and renamed the MK Dons, could be up in the Football League next year. What a fantastic achievement that would be! They could then face the aforementioned MK Dons in the Football League in a matter of seasons. What a game that would be, and what a moment if AFC Wimbledon were to beat the team that effectively abolished Wimbledon and caused all those fans to lose their club. |
